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: ? TCM constitution is divided into qi-stagnation (qi-stagnation transformation score = 40 points); ? aged 18 ~ 23 years; ? diet and sleep are basically normal, body mass index is between 18.5-23.9, and do not like tobacco, alcohol, tea and coffee (absolutely not allowed the night before MRI); ? right-handed; ? sign informed consent and voluntarily accept the test.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: ? Brain lesions were found by CT examination; ? Those who have other heart, kidney, liver diseases and tumors and affect the test results; ? Those who received transcranial magnetic stimulation, transcranial direct current therapy, or EEG biofeedback therapy at the same time; ? Those who receive drugs and other treatments at the same time; ? Those who received auricular therapy within 1 month before the test; ? Patients who are or have been diagnosed with depression; ? Allergic to ear point adhesive tape; ? There are metal substances in the body; ? Claustrophobia, which affects the communication and operator during the experiment; ? Usually dysmenorrhea and pregnant women.
